ISSUES: The Applicant/Owner has requested an extension of the deadline by which all conditions of a previously approved Amended and Re-enacted Ordinance of Encroachment ( 2016 Ordinance ) must be met from the existing deadline of March 14, 2018 until July 1, 2020. The reason for the extension request is so that the deadline for the fulfillment of the conditions of the 2016 Ordinance is extended to coincide with the deadline for vesting of the underlying site plan, which deadline was extended by law by the Virginia General Assembly to July 1, 2020. SUMMARY: The Applicant/Owner has requested a second amendment and reenactment ( Amended Ordinance ) of the 2016 Ordinance which is associated with Site Plan #435 for the purpose of extending the deadline by which all the conditions of the 2016 Ordinance must be met. On March 14, 2015, the County Board enacted an Ordinance of Encroachment with a deadline of March 14, 2018 ( 2015 Ordinance ). On April 16, 2016, the County Board amended and re-enacted the 2015 Ordinance to reflect a change in the location of the electric vault moving it farther south into the alley from the location previously approved by the County Board ( 2016 Ordinance ). No other terms or conditions from the 2015 Ordinance were changed. The Applicant/Owner has requested the extension of the date for fulfillment of the conditions of the 2016 Ordinance so that the 2016 Ordinance deadline coincides with the deadline for vesting the underlying site plan. If the Amended Ordinance is enacted, the Applicant/Owner would have until July 1, 2020 to satisfy the Amended Ordinance conditions. The Amended Ordinance will permit the encroachment of a portion of an underground garage into the right-of-way for Clarendon Boulevard ( Garage Encroachment ) and the encroachment of a portion of a below grade electric vault into an alley ( Electric Vault Encroachment ) (collectively, Encroachments ) abutting the eastern border of Site Plan #435. The Amended Ordinance is required to permit the location of the underground garage and the electric vault as proposed in the Site Plan. If the Amended Ordinance is enacted by the County Board, permission for the Encroachments would continue until the garage and/or the electric vault are destroyed, removed, no longer in use, or not continuously and promptly maintained by the Applicant/Owner. BACKGROUND: The Applicant/Owner obtained approval for a new Site Plan #435 ( Site Plan ) to construct a 12-story, approximately 195,870 square foot office building with approximately 7,000 square feet of ground floor retail. The Site Plan is located on two parcels of land ( Property ) upon which a Wendy s fast food restaurant and a Wells Fargo Bank branch were located. The site is bounded by Wilson Boulevard to the north, an alley to the east, Clarendon Boulevard to the south, and a small portion of North Courthouse Road to the west, where Wilson and Clarendon Boulevards converge. The requested Garage Encroachment would permit location of a portion of five floors of the proposed underground parking garage within the County right-of-way for Clarendon Boulevard and the requested Electric Vault Encroachment would permit location of a portion of a proposed underground electric vault within an existing County alley located to the east of the Property. - 2 -

DISCUSSION: The Applicant/Owner requests that the County Board enact the Amended Ordinance for the purpose of extending the deadline by which all of the conditions of the 2016 Ordinance must be met. The Applicant/Owner must complete all the conditions of the Amended Ordinance in order to construct an underground garage and electric vault as part of the planned Site Plan improvements. To comply with the proposed Site Plan, the Applicant/Owner has requested enactment of the Amended Ordinance to permit the Garage Encroachment, which consists of encroachment of a 2,673 square foot portion, for five levels, of the underground parking garage within the Clarendon Boulevard right-of-way. Although the Garage Encroachment would be located underground in the right-of-way, the underground garage would be physically located behind the back of curb of Clarendon Boulevard. In other words, the Garage Encroachment would not be beneath travel lanes of the street, but would be beneath sidewalk for the proposed Site Plan. The proposed Garage Encroachment is designated on a plat attached hereto as Exhibit A as Parking Vault Encroachment: 2,673 SF, entitled Plat Showing Encroachment Areas 2025 Clarendon Boulevard Deed Book 4285, Page 2341 RPC 17-011-011, Deed Book 2039, Page 1632 RPC 17-011-012, Arlington County, Virginia, pages 1-3 of 3, prepared by Bohler Engineering and dated April 15, 2014, last revised January 4, 2018 ( Plat ). The far southeastern corner of the proposed Garage Encroachment is located near and above the existing Metro tunnel and track for the subway. To insure that the location of the garage does not interfere with the Metro tunnel, the Ordinance will be subject to, and conditioned upon, the Applicant/Owner first securing WMATA approval of the relevant final engineering plans for the Site Plan and all necessary WMATA permits from Joint Development and Adjacent Construction under the WMATA Adjacent Construction Program. In addition, to comply with the proposed Site Plan, the Applicant/Owner has requested enactment of the Amended Ordinance to permit the Electric Vault Encroachment, which consists of the encroachment of a 505 square foot portion of the underground electric vault into an existing County alley. The proposed Electric Vault Encroachment is designated as Electrical Vault Encroachment: 505 SF on the Plat. Legal and Physical Description: The Property is owned by 2025 Clarendon Boulevard, LLC by virtue of deeds recorded in the Land Records as Instrument No. 20160100001102 and as Instrument No. 20150100026023. The right-of-way for Clarendon Boulevard, into which the Garage Encroachment encroaches, was established by a plat of subdivision for Fort Myer Heights recorded among the Land Records in Deed Book M4 at Page 322 and Deed Book N4 at Page 50. The alley into which the Electric Vault Encroachment encroaches was established by Deed of Resubdivision, Dedications and Easements, dated August 14, 2014, recorded among the Land Records in Deed Book 4788 at Page 1339. Public Notice: Public notice was given in accordance with the Code of Virginia. Notices were placed in the January 3, 2018 and the January 10, 2018, issues of The Washington Times for the January 27, 2018 County Board Meeting. - 3 -

Compensation: Compensation in the amount of $445,000.00 will be charged for the Garage Encroachment based upon an appraisal from a certified independent appraiser. The Applicant/Owner has agreed to pay this amount of compensation to the County. Because the County desires placement of electric vaults underground, the County s practice is not to require compensation to the County for the encroachment of an electric vault. PUBLIC ENGAGEMENT: In addition to the required advertisement of the Amended Ordinance, the original encroachments and/or the site plan approval were the subject of meetings with the community and the County Board in 2015 and 2016. Additionally, the 2016 Ordinance was advertised for the April 2016 County Board Meeting. FISCAL IMPACT: The County will receive $445,000.00 from the Applicant/Owner as compensation for the Encroachments. The amount will be tendered by the Applicant/Owner and deposited in the County s General Fund, at the times, and in the amounts, required by the Amended Ordinance. - 4 -

BE IT ORDAINED by the County Board of Arlington County, Virginia that, pursuant to an application on file with the Department of Environmental Services, Real Estate Bureau, the Applicant and Owner, 2025 Clarendon Boulevard, LLC, ( Applicant/Owner ), as developer of the project known as 2025 Clarendon Boulevard, Site Plan #435 ( Site Plan ), and the Owner of the property known as 2025 Clarendon Boulevard, RPC #17-011-011 and 17-011-012, upon which the Site Plan is being constructed ( Property ) is hereby permitted to construct: 1) a portion of an underground garage ( Garage Encroachment ) into an area dedicated for Clarendon Boulevard ( Street ) running east to west abutting the southern boundary of the Property, such right-of-way dedicated to the County by Subdivision Plat recorded in Deed Book M4 at Page 322 and Deed Book N4 at Page 50 among the land records of Arlington County, Virginia ( Land Records ); and 2) a portion of an Electric Vault into an alley ( Alley ) abutting the eastern boundary of the Property ( Electric Vault Encroachment ), such Alley dedicated to the County by Deed of Resubdivision, Dedications and Easements, dated August 14, 2014, recorded in Deed Book 4788 at Page 1339 among the Land Records. The dimensions (length, width and depth elevations) and the spatial location of the Garage Encroachment are depicted as Parking Vault Encroachment: 2,673 SF on Exhibit A, attached to the County Manager s Report dated January 4, 2018, and entitled Plat Showing Encroachment Areas, 2025 Clarendon Boulevard, Deed Book 4285, Page 2341 RPC 17-011-011, Deed Book 2039, Page 1632 RPC 17-011-012, Arlington County, Virginia, pages 1-3 of 3, prepared by Bohler Engineering and dated April 15, 2014 and last revised January 4, 2018 ( Plat ). The dimensions (length, width and depth elevations) and the spatial location of the Electric Vault Encroachment are depicted as Electrical Vault Encroachment: 505 SF on the Plat. The dimensions, elevations, depth below grade, spatial location, characteristics and spatial area of the permitted Garage Encroachment and Electric Vault Encroachment are shown on the Plat. No other structures are permitted to be installed or constructed by Applicant/Owner, or to exist within the county property shown on the Plat. The permissions for both the Garage Encroachment and the Electric Vault Encroachment are subject to the following conditions: - 5 -

BE IT FURTHER ORDAINED that this permission for the Garage Encroachment is subject to, and conditioned upon, the Applicant/Owner first securing WMATA approval of the relevant final engineering plans for the Site Plan and all necessary WMATA permits from Joint Development and Adjacent Construction under the WMATA Adjacent Construction Program. BE IT FURTHER ORDAINED that these permissions for the Garage Encroachment and the Electric Vault Encroachment authorized by the Ordinance shall continue until such time as that portion of the Garage Encroachment encroaching within the Street or that portion of the Electric Vault Encroachment encroaching within the Alley, as the case may be, are destroyed, removed, no longer in use, or not continuously and promptly maintained by the Applicant/Owner. Nothing in this Ordinance shall be constructed either: to allow the installation by the Applicant/Owner of any above ground structure or any structure other than the portion of the Garage Encroachment and the Electric Vault Encroachment within the areas shown on the Plat; or to allow any greater encroachment behind the dimensions and spatial areas shown on the Plat. BE IT FURTHER ORDAINED that the Applicant/Owner, and its successors and assigns, shall continuously and promptly maintain the below grade structures, and maintain, restore, repair, and replace all County owned facilities, within and adjacent to the Street and the Alley, including any sidewalk, curb and gutter and paved surface, which are damaged by the installation, maintenance, destruction, continued existence, repair or removal of the below grade Garage Encroachment and Electric Vault Encroachment, in accordance with the Site Plan and all applicable County standards. BE IT FURTHER ORDAINED that the Applicant/Owner shall pay to the County $445,000.00 in compensation for the Garage Encroachment. BE IT FURTHER ORDAINED that this Ordinance shall not be construed to release the Applicant/Owner, and its successors and assigns, of negligence on its part due to such Garage Encroachment and Electric Vault Encroachment. The Applicant/Owner, by constructing, or causing to be constructed a portion of the underground garage in the Street and the underground electric vault in the Alley, hereby agrees for itself, and its successors and assigns, to indemnify and hold harmless the County Board of Arlington County, Virginia and all County officials, officer, employees, contractors, and agents from all claims, negligence, damages, costs and expenses arising out of the existence, construction, maintenance, repair and removal of the underground garage and the underground electric vault, and the permission for the portions of the Garage Encroachment to encroach within the Street and the Electric Vault Encroachment to encroach within the Alley as permitted by the Ordinance. BE IT FURTHER ORDAINED that, on or before noon on July 1, 2020, the Applicant/Owner, at its sole cost and expense, shall comply with all conditions of this Ordinance and thereafter cause a certified copy of this Ordinance and the Plat, which Plat shall be approved by the Director of the Department of Environmental Services, or his designee, to be recorded in the Land Records and evidence thereof shall be promptly delivered by the Applicant/Owner to the Real Estate Bureau Chief, Department of Environmental Services. - 6 -
